Product

Problem

Enterprises struggle to move multi‑agent AI prototypes into reliable production because workflows become fragile, execution is opaque, and costs can explode due to uncontrolled token usage.

Solution

CortexOps offers AgentFlow, a native orchestration platform that provides a control plane for provisioning, routing, and monitoring autonomous AI agents at scale. Users design complex, multi‑step workflows with a visual node‑based editor, assign custom system prompts and toolsets to each agent, and enforce execution constraints such as token budgets and approval steps. The platform delivers granular observability, logging execution times, token consumption, and step‑by‑step outputs, enabling deterministic and secure operation of thousands of agents. By integrating an extensible tool registry, AgentFlow connects agents to search, code execution, web scraping, and internal APIs without custom glue code, turning experimental prototypes into production‑ready business processes.

Target Audience

Primary customers are enterprise engineering and operations teams that need to deploy scalable, reliable multi‑agent AI solutions for use cases such as support triage, data research, and code review automation.

Features

  • Visual workflow editor with node‑based design for branching logic and agent handoffs
  • Agent provisioning with custom system prompts, personas, and dedicated toolsets
  • Extensible tool registry supporting search, code execution, web scraping, and API integrations
  • Granular observability including per‑node execution logs, latency metrics, and token usage analytics
  • Execution controls such as sandboxing, token budgets, and approval nodes to prevent runaway costs
  • API and dashboard interfaces for triggering workflows and reviewing results in real time
